The spinal cord is a long, thin, tubular bundle of nerves that extends from the brain down through the center of the spine.In total, the human body has 33 vertebrae which are placed in the following way: 7 cervical, 12 thoracic, 5 lumbar, 5 sacral, and 4 coccygeal vertebrae (the number is sometimes increased by an additional vertebra in one region, or it may be diminished in another).The vertebral column (spine) is the bony core of the back.The vertebral column is also known as the spinal column or spine (Figure 1).

Along with the skull, ribs, and sternum, these vertebrae make up the axial skeletal .In humans, it is composed of 33 vertebrae that include 7 cervical, 12 thoracic, 5 lumbar, 5 sacral, and 4 coccygeal.
